apparently my problem is I cannot update initramfs:

update-initramfs: Generating /boot/initrd.img-6.12.41+deb13-amd64 zstd: error 70 : Write error : cannot write block : No space left on device

After checking KDE Partition Manager for /boot and /boot/efi both have free space left:

/boot size: 488 MiB

/boot used: 396.26 MiB

/boot/efi size: 512 MiB

/boot/efi used: 10.52 MiB

dpkg -l | grep linux-image | awk '{print$2}' shows:

linux-image-6.1.0-37-amd64

linux-image-6.1.0-38-amd64

linux-image-6.12.41+deb13-amd64

linux-image-amd64

I am now using debian 13 on linux-image-6.1.0-38-amd64 because linux-image-6.12.41+deb13-amd64 won’t load from grub2. I don’t want to get rid of linux-image-6.1.0-37-amd64 till I solve this issue

    Checking the /boot size on my Fedora install, I partitioned out a gibibyte for the 3 kernel plus recovery kernel setup, which takes up about 338 MiB in total. Depending on out-of-tree kernel modules and bootloader modifications installed, your initramfs images could be larger. A few things to look for:

    • the size of your current initramfs and vmlinuz image(s)
    • any kernel modules you needed to install alongside your system (v4l2-loopback, nvidia, realtek, etc.)
    • If there are other large files present in the boot partition

    If everything there looks fine and/or is necessary, you might need to expand your /boot partition (either reinstall if new system or offline partition shrinking, moving after a data backup if you have personal files you care about).

    I ran into a problem like this once, and after banging my head against the wall for days it turned out the solution was just running

    sudo apt autoremove
    

    That took care of removing a bunch of old stuff in the boot partition that I will not pretend to understand.

    With the size of modern linux kernels, I think 1GiB for a /boot partition is the absolute minimum I would go for a current full-sized distributuon. You’ll run into these out-of-space issues on updates all the time otherwise.
